Government Affairs & CSR Senior Specialist

JCpenney is looking for a Government Affairs & Corporate Social Responsibility Senior Specialist to join our team, reporting to the Head of Government Affairs.

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Develop monthly policy and politics newsletters to be distributed to internal stakeholders.
  • Administers and maintains policies and objectives involving local, state, and federal government affairs.
  • Legislatively supports and protects organization interests by working with government, associated authorities and all committees.
  • Monitors legislative and regulatory activities, oversees the implementation of policies that support organizational goals.
  • Analyzes proposed legislative actions and determines the potential impact on the organization.
  • Assisting the company in the development, management, and modification of social responsibility policies.
  • Increasing public awareness of a company\'s social responsibility commitments through marketing.
  • Reiterating the company\'s social responsibility policies through internal communication.

Core Competencies & Accomplishments:
  • High proficiency in Microsoft Word, PowerPoint, and Excel is required.
  • Awareness of current political leadership and government policy trends.
  • Bachelor\'s Degree required.
  • Previous experience and success with stakeholder advocavy and education initiatives.
  • Exceptional interpersonal, written and oral communication skills.
  • Demonstrated ability to effectively and comfortably interact in a small team environment and to multi-task a number of projects at once.
  • Strong judgment and decision-making skills, and good political insight.
  • Strong external stakeholder engagement experience.
  • A well-defined sense of diplomacy, including solid negotiation, conflict resolution, and relationship management skills.
  • Understanding the legislative process (State and Federal).
  • Exceptional communication skills, including storytelling to effectively convey the organizations purpose and impact.
  • 2-5 years experience in Government Affairs or closely related position.

About JCPenney:

JCPenney is the shopping destination for diverse, working American families. With inclusivity at its core, the Company\'s product assortment meets customers\' everyday needs and helps them commemorate every special occasion with style, quality and value. JCPenney offers a broad portfolio of fashion, apparel, home, beauty and jewelry from national and private brands and provides personal services including salon, portrait and optical. The Company and its 50,000 associates worldwide serve customers where, when and how they want to shop - from jcp.com to more than 650 stores in the U.S. and Puerto Rico. In 2022, JCPenney celebrates 120 years as an iconic American brand by continuing its legacy of connecting with customers through shopping and community engagement.
